03 • Offline Architecture

How do your business systems handle internet outages and warehouse dead zones?

Our systems utilize an Offline-First Persistence Model leveraging a local Dexie.js database and IndexedDB. Scanning and check-out transactions are securely queued locally. The exact millisecond network connectivity is restored, a background service worker bundles the pending queue and executes atomic batched commits to the cloud.

04 • Inventory Integrity

How do you prevent inventory double-encoding when multiple staff are counting?

We implement Pessimistic Locking and Delta Adjustments. Real-time listeners temporarily lock a specific SKU to the active user's device. Furthermore, the system records delta changes (e.g., adding +50 items) instead of absolute totals, entirely eliminating "last-write-wins" overwrite collisions.

06 • Financial Vault

How does the Immutable Audit Vault protect against financial theft?

To guarantee absolute data integrity, our systems completely remove front-end "Delete" buttons and enforce a strict Void Protocol requiring a manager PIN. Every manual change triggers an immutable audit log that is permanently written to the server and cannot be altered or destroyed from the client side.

09 • Geo-Fencing & ABAC

How does Attribute-Based Access Control (ABAC) prevent stolen credentials?

ABAC layers HTML5 Geolocation and device fingerprinting over standard login procedures. If a login is attempted from an unrecognized device more than 50 kilometers away from a user's known location, the system automatically quarantines the account and flags the owner to prevent data theft.

10 • Data Retention

Why do you use Soft Deletes instead of permanently erasing product data?

To preserve the mathematical integrity of historical audit logs, the inventory system enforces a Soft Delete or Archive Protocol. Deactivating an obsolete product removes it from active warehouse scanning lists but safely preserves all past ledger calculations and logs tied to that specific item.
